公开了生产产品的方法:a)提供包括定义工作流程中所需全部资源的多个产品段的产品生产规则PPR;b)接收客户请求并据以创建生产请求,将抽象资源工作流程(表示满足客户请求的生产步骤A至D的工作流程)从相关PPR复制到生产请求中来创建生产请求;c)执行生产如下:与生产请求创建异步地应用生产请求;将PPR的资源(替换步骤A有关抽象资源)加到生产请求中,以仅把实际使用资源复制到生产请求中;在资源上执行相应生产步骤;d)执行产品生产如下:逐步重复步骤c),直到在与步骤A至D的工作流程有关的抽象资源工作流程中,所有抽象资源被实际使用资源替换。通过逐步地应用后期绑定方法,实现生产请求创建周期的显著缩短及所用存储器空间的减少。
【技术实现步骤摘要】
生产产品的方法
本专利技术涉及用于生产产品的方法,所述生产由根据ISA-S95标准进行工作的制造执行系统控制和管理。
技术介绍
在过程自动化和过程监控领域中,用于控制最大可能种类的机器和车间的标准自动化系统是最先进的。用于这些所谓的制造执行系统(MES)的相关的标准是ISA-S95。该技术尤其覆盖西门子公司(SiemensCorp.)在制造执行系统(MES)领域内在其(注册商标)产品族下所提供的各种各样的产品。标准ISA-S95转变成用于集成制造操作功能和企业功能的标准化的术语、概念和模型。这种标准化通过定义企业功能视图的ISA-S95得以实现,这使得能够将工作行为的简单通用模型应用于主要的制造领域。用于解决所讨论的诸如计数、测量、定位、运动控制、闭环控制和凸轮控制的技术任务的广泛产品线提升合适的过程控制器的性能。多种配置使得能够实现灵活的机器概念。在该背景下,存在广泛的IT解决方案,以将与技术的和/或逻辑的过程关系密切的实际硬件连接至驱动设备的客户端应用层。因此,已开发了制造执行系统以满足面向服务的架构(SOA)的所有需求,从而无缝集成到全集成自动化(TIA)中。即插即用架构构成了这种成功的基础,由此简化了用于控制制造车间等的复杂结构,其中,在即插即用架构中,能够彼此容易地组合和配置各个功能。在主干中,这些要求经常需要相当复杂且尖端的软件方案,这些软件方案使全集成自动化(TIA)方法成为可能。鉴于此,软件工程师经常使用生产建模器来定义车间模型及其标准的操作过程,并且通过标识软件内行为的工作流程的高级图形语言来创建相应的新软件。随后,该高级图形语言串/项被翻译成能够在机器语言级别上执行的基于客户端的软件语言。这种翻译需要编程上的巨大工作,并且需要严格测试以检查所翻译的程序是否与原始的高级图形语言串/项一样动作。也就是说,在SIMATICIT生产套装软件中,SIMATICIT生产建模器(SIMATICITProductionModeler)提供了一种建模环境,在该环境中图形地结合了SIMATICIT部件(诸如材料、机器、人员、工具、软件部件的生产资源)提供的各种功能,以定义表示操作程序的执行逻辑。这些逻辑被称为生产操作,且被表示为产品生产规则PPR(工作流程),在产品生产规则PPR中每个步骤均表示由部件提供的功能的执行。为了实现此,SIMATICIT生产建模器还提供用以建立车间模型的建模环境,这对于定义车间的各种行为是必不可少的。为了以技术方式对生产系统建模,需要将用产品生产规则定义的生产过程划分为许多步骤(下文中称产品段PS),使得产品段中的每一个均表示能够被MES系统控制的简单动作或特征。为了保证以正确的方式执行整个生产,这种细分必须考虑到存在于产品段之间的所有依赖性。通常,通过其中登记产品段的产品生产规则(PPR)在中央MES数据库中管理产品段。就汽车制造而言,鉴于通常由汽车工业来提供所有变型和选择,所以能够容易地作为一个示例。从汽车的基本模型开始,必须考虑例如以下方面的全部可能的组合:用于引擎(例如1600、1800、2000、2500)的产品段、用于变速器(例如4档、4自动挡、5档、5自动挡)的产品段以及用于车轮(钢轮、轻合金车轮-标准、轻合金车轮-宽胎)的产品段。因此,如果想针对所有可能的组合定义产品生产规则(PPR),则可能已经定义了48个PPR(在48个示例PPR中,针对每种可能的组合都有一个PPR)。因此,很明显,即使是管理用于更大量PPR或PS的产品段的本领域的技术人员也要利用自动过滤器,以实现产品请求,该动作的处理时间可能很长,并且在最坏的情况下,本领域的技术人员将不得不手动地更新数据库或定义数据库中的结构的新变化,以尽可能地使其保持简单和透明。在离散生产产品时,生产请求表示针对生产满足客户请求的单个产品的请求,例如具有确定的引擎、确定的变速器以及确定的车轮的汽车。因此,MES环境中的生产请求是若干外部的和混合的数据资源的集成的结果,然而生产请求往往由特定的产品生产规则PPR所确定。因此,PPR可以被认为是用于生产请求的模板。如ISA-S95中所定义的,PPR包括在生产客户请求所要求的最终产品期间所需要的所有资源的定义的整体。通过PPR,可以生成生产请求,这是因为就如下意义来说PPR是模板:PPR定义应该如何制造最终产品(在生产阶段或步骤方面)以及该行为需要什么资源。遗憾的是,生产请求的创建可能要花费好几分钟,且需要巨大数量的数据库访问行为。事实上,根据ISA-S95的规定,产品生产规则可以由几千个产品段构成,其中每个产品段均定义该特定生产步骤所需的资源。该巨大数量的数据包括理论上可用的资源的所有可能模式,其中该资源可以在不早于生产请求的实际执行期间被明确地确定。实际上,在不考虑资源的状态(例如,工作中、维修中、闲置等)的情况下,作为创建生产请求的基础的PPR包括其资源当中将要被使用的所有可能的设备。当然,在PPR的定义期间,生产建模应当考虑在执行生产请求期间可能发生的每个可能的格局(constellation)。目前,为了管理产品的生产,一般方法是使用PPR作为针对每个生产请求的模板。当从ERP系统(层4)得到客户请求时,以关联的PPR开始实例化新的生产请求。复制(克隆)PPR的满足客户请求的所有资源(考虑运行时能够被执行的资源的每种可能的组合),并且获得表示产品请求的新结构。由于以下事实,这种操作可能花费相当长的时间:PPR包括在执行基于客户请求的生产请求期间所需要的所有可能的资源(材料、设备、生产步骤、步骤依赖性、人员要求、过程参数等等)。应该指出,在该阶段,在该生产中相当大部分资源不会被使用,其中这些资源是根据客户请求在生产的结束时被复制到生产请求中的资源。当考虑用于制造航天器引擎的PPR的示例时,现有技术的问题将容易变得更加明显:该PPR通常具有上千个步骤。考虑到这些生产步骤之一是航天器引擎的若干零件的装配,可以使用存在于不同的车间生产线(plantlines)上的特定安装设备在相应的车间生产线上执行该装配。通常,工厂具有不同的车间生产线,但在该执行之前,操作员将不会知晓将使用哪个车间生产线,也不知晓将需要哪个设备。因此,PPR必须把所有可能的车间生产线都看作执行该装配的特定生产步骤的候选。没有任何策略地从该PPR开始创建新的生产请求将导致在创建生产请求所需的时间以及MES系统所使用的存储器方面的不良结果,这是因为在PPR中的所有配置的车间生产线中,最终仅有一条车间生产线用于执行相应的生产步骤。此外,在创建生产请求时,通常不知晓关于最终所使用的车间生产线的信息,这是因为用于装配的最终的车间生产线通常取决于非先验已知的多个其它车间信息(状态)数据。
技术实现思路
因此,本专利技术的一个目的是提供用于生产产品的方法,其中由符合ISA-S95标准的制造执行系统来控制所述生产,其可以以更少的时间和存储器占用根据相应的PPR改善生产请求的创建。根据本专利技术,该目的通过用于生产产品的方法得以实现,由根据ISA-S95标准进行工作的制造执行系统控制和执行该生产,该生产包括以下步骤:a)提供用于生产所述产品的产品生产规则,其中所述产品生产规则包括多个产品段,从而定义在所述生产的生产步骤的本文档来自技高网...
【技术保护点】
一种用于生产产品(汽车)的方法,所述生产由根据ISA‑S95标准进行工作的制造执行系统控制和执行,所述方法包括以下步骤:a)提供用于生产所述产品(汽车)的产品生产规则(PPR),其中所述产品生产规则(PPR)包括多个产品段,从而定义在所述生产的生产步骤的工作流程期间所需要的全部资源,例如材料、设备、人员;b)接收针对所述产品(汽车)的生产的客户请求并根据所述客户请求创建针对所述生产的执行的生产请求,其中为创建所述生产请求,通过将抽象资源的工作流程从所述相关的产品生产规则(PPR)复制到所述生产请求中来实例化所述生产请求,所述抽象资源的工作流程表示满足所述客户请求的生产步骤(A至D)的工作流程;c)通过以下操作执行所述生产:与所述生产请求的创建相异步地应用所述生产请求;将来自所述产品生产规则(PPR)的资源添加到所述生产请求中,所述资源替换与第一生产步骤(A)有关的所述抽象资源,从而仅把实际使用的资源复制到所述生产请求中;以及在所述资源上执行相应的生产步骤;d)通过以下操作执行所述产品(汽车)的所述生产:逐步地重复步骤c),直到在与所述生产步骤(A至D)的工作流程有关的抽象资源的所述工作流程中,所有抽象资源都已经被在所述生产步骤中所述实际使用的资源所替换。...
【技术特征摘要】
2013.12.02 EP 13195294.71.一种用于生产产品的方法,所述生产由根据ISA-S95标准进行工作的制造执行系统控制和执行,所述方法包括以下步骤:a)提供用于生产所述产品的产品生产规则(PPR),其中所述产品生产规则(PPR)包括多个产品段,从而定义在所述生产的生产步骤的工作流程期间所需要的全部资源;b)接收针对所述产品的生产的客户请求并根据所述客户请求创建针对所述生产的执行的生产请求,其中为创建所述生产请求,通过将抽象资源的工作流程从所述相关的产品生产规则(PPR)复制到所述生产请求中来实例化所述生产请求,所述抽象资源的工作流程表示满足所述客户请求的生产步骤(A至D)的工作流程;c)通过以下操作执行所述生产:与所述生产请求的创建相...
【专利技术属性】
技术研发人员:亚历山德罗·拉维奥拉,埃琳娜·雷焦,
申请(专利权)人:西门子公司,
类型:发明
国别省市:德国;DE
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。